Output 40c5caebe863408e770d55b70e90f64bb45520224a229eed8017f77ed14fc66a:1

value
663430475
script pubkey
OP_0 OP_PUSHBYTES_20 237ee376ce306d04b7c08fbc3f88479e565745bb
address
tb1qydlwxakwxpksfd7q377rlzz8net9w3dm05cgc7
transaction
40c5caebe863408e770d55b70e90f64bb45520224a229eed8017f77ed14fc66a
confirmations
104425
spent
true